Arsenal scored 68 goals last season, and 5 less this at 63. Chelsea scored one more goal than the Gunners did this season a total of 64. All that money and they have scored 19 goals less than Manchester United, and only one more than Arsenal. They got that total with Drogba, Shevchenko, J. Cole and Robben all available. Arsenal nearly equalled them without van Persie available from the end of January, and Henry injured for most of the season.
